How does Islamic art differ from Western art traditions? 
 
 Islamic art often emphasizes abstract patterns, calligraphy, and non-figurative designs, 
focusing on spiritual representation rather than the human form, which is more common in 
Western art traditions.

Helix Test Questions & Answers 2024/2025 
 
 
Helix-Turn-Helix - ANSWERSdna binding motif which has two alpha helices connected by a turn 
 
zinc finger - ANSWERSa DNA-binding motif that typifies a class of transcription factor 
 
leucine zipper motif - ANSWERSA structural motif found in a number of proteins (some of the DNA-binding regulatory proteins) in which leucyl residues align along one edge of the helix and can interdigitate with a similar structure on another protein molecule
